
Looks like Jennie Garth isn’t the only Beverly Hills, 90210 alum returning to her old zip code.
Tori Spelling – who played Donna Martin – has been tapped to co-star in the new spin-off version of the ’90s hit teen drama, a source confirms to Usmagazine.com.
“She will be a recurring character,” the source adds.
DeadlineHollywoodDaily.com first reported the news.
“I am excited about it,” Spelling told Us in April when asked about the new version.
“In some way, every show that followed 90210 was a remake of 90210,” she added. “For the fans’ sake, I am really happy for them.”
Spelling’s father Aaron created and produced the original series.
Former Full House star Lori Loughlin has also signed on and The CW has also hinted that other original 90210 stars could be reprising their roles.
